Plasma Network Performance

Network

Plasma Network Performance, within the context of cryptocurrency derivatives, fundamentally assesses the operational efficiency and scalability of Plasma chains relative to the underlying main chain. This evaluation extends beyond mere transaction throughput, encompassing factors such as data availability, exit game efficiency, and overall system responsiveness under varying load conditions. Effective monitoring and analysis of network performance are crucial for optimizing gas costs, minimizing latency, and ensuring the reliability of decentralized applications built upon Plasma. Ultimately, robust Plasma Network Performance is a prerequisite for widespread adoption of Layer-2 scaling solutions in complex financial instruments.
